Reamed and New GPs, New Nozzles PT to Spec New Car, almost
Just had my injectors rebuilt to spec with bosio nozzles, installed today along with some new glow plugs and reamed the gp holes (used a 7mm tap mostly by hand with a pair or pliers to turn into the hole then shop vac the carbon out) on my 1985 w123. Man what a difference, no pedal needed to start and starts up right after gp light goes out. Think I was on original bosch nozzles and she was a ***** to start even here in socal where a cold morning is like 50-55. Real test will be cold start tomorrow morning but my confidence is high and she is idling smooth and even. If you have 200k or more and have never done this, do it, worth the money and 4 hours time to do the job once you have the injectors rebuilt. Found a local shop in Anaheim that did mine for rock bottom price of $15 per injector.
